2024 BMW 530i M Sport Package: Specs, Price & Test Drive Review

The BMW 530i M Sport package represents a compelling sweet spot in the luxury sedan segment, blending refined performance with everyday practicality. This specific trim level sits above the standard 530i, injecting a dose of dynamic character typically associated with the higher-performance M340i and M models. For buyers seeking enhanced handling, a more aggressive aesthetic, and premium features without venturing into the true M performance realm, the M Sport package is often the ideal configuration.

Defining the M Sport Package

It is crucial to understand that the M Sport designation is a performance and styling package, not a distinct engine variant. When you opt for the BMW 530i M Sport, you are equipping the efficient turbocharged 2.0-liter four-cylinder engine with the M Sport package's signature upgrades. This means the core mechanicals remain focused on efficiency and smoothness, while the package transforms the visual and tactile experience of driving the vehicle. The result is a sedan that looks more purposeful and feels significantly more connected to the road than its base counterpart.

Exterior Styling and Aggressive Design Language

The visual transformation is immediate and striking. The M Sport package introduces a host of design elements that set the 530i apart on the road. A more pronounced front bumper with larger air shutters, paired with a distinctive kidney grille insert, gives the front end a wider and more aggressive stance. Darker chrome exterior trim is replaced with gloss black finishes, including the mirror caps and window surrounds, creating a cohesive and sporty silhouette. The signature LED headlights, often with adaptive functionality, are framed by darkened surrounds that add to the overall menacing yet elegant look.

Performance Dynamics and Handling Refinements

Under the hood, the 530i M Sport retains the excellent 2.0-liter turbocharged engine, producing 255 horsepower and 295 lb-ft of torque. This powertrain is mated to an 8-speed automatic transmission and powers the rear wheels, delivering a balance of efficiency and pep that is perfect for both highway cruising and urban driving. The true value of the M Sport package, however, is realized through its handling upgrades. A lowered sports suspension, larger 18-inch alloy wheels wrapped in performance tires, and an enhanced steering system transform the sedan's response. The ride is firmer but well-damped, providing confident cornering and a more engaged driving experience without sacrificing the plush ride quality that BMW is known for.

Premium Interior and Technology Features

Step inside, and the M Sport theme continues with the interior appointments. The driver is embraced by a cockpit-inspired layout, featuring high-quality, soft-touch materials and genuine leather upholstery. M Sport-specific sport seats with enhanced bolsters provide excellent lateral support during spirited driving, while the flat-bottomed steering wheel wrapped in leather offers a superb grip. The digital instrument cluster and the large central infotainment screen are standard, ensuring the cabin feels modern and technologically advanced. Convenience features such as power-adjustable front seats, a panoramic moonroof, and a premium sound system are typically bundled within this package, delivering a luxurious and well-equipped environment.

Comparing the Trim Levels

To fully appreciate the 530i M Sport, it is helpful to compare it to the base 530i and its performance sibling, the 530i xDrive M Sport. The base model provides the essential BMW luxury and technology but lacks the aesthetic and dynamic enhancements. The M Sport package adds significant value in terms of looks, feel, and handling. The xDrive M Sport, on the other hand, includes the M Sport package with the addition of all-wheel drive, which is beneficial in adverse weather conditions or for those who prefer extra traction. Choosing between the two often comes down to a decision between standard rear-wheel drive for a more pure driving experience or all-wheel drive for added confidence in various conditions.
